This is a neat shoujo isekai series about a lady who becomes a really good healer and ends up embroiled in state level politics because of it.

That might not sound super exciting but I wouldn't recommend it if I didn't think it was good and worth it.

I like that instead of just casting healing spells she's doing like magical er surgery and removing foreign bodies and merging bone fractures, but with magic.

Hosaka-sensei no Ai no Muchi
Kawai Karen is a girl with an evil-looking face, who finally achieved her dream of becoming a nursery teacher. Problem is, her face makes the children around her cry on a daily basis. At the same time, there is a handsome man in charge of the same class as her who can seemingly do anything. This Hosaka-sensei is also incredibly popular among the children... but he is a little too serious. One day he told Karen that, "From today onward we will begin our companionship with the intent of marriage"... He proposed to her!?

it's cute :3:
